/UDP, DNS ....) Very good understanding of the common security standard and practice Good understanding of modern software development practices (code review, TDD, Agile) Genuine passion for working in a team and building great products that delight end users. Drive for excellence and improvement Experience working with Terraform more »
Design, develop, and maintain scalable software applications using Java, Kotlin, JavaScript, React, and TypeScript. Implement automated testing and ensure code quality through Test-DrivenDevelopment (TDD). Participate in code reviews, providing constructive feedback to ensure code quality and adherence to best practices. Collaborate with cross-functional … At least 5 years of professional experience in software development. Strong proficiency in Java, Kotlin, JavaScript, React, and TypeScript. Experience with automated testing and TDD practices. Familiarity with CI/CD tools and pipelines (e.g., Jenkins, GitHub Actions, CircleCI). Excellent problem-solving skills and attention to detail. Strong communication more »
hybrid nature. Fortnightly tech office days are the only mandatory on-site requirement. Skills : AWS: ECS, Lambda, API Gateway, SNS/SQS TestDrivenDevelopment CI/CD A flair for identifying good UX more »
either Kotlin or Java ✅ Experience of mentoring and coaching, influencing teams and guiding technical direction ✅ Strong experience of working with Agile methodologies and strong TDD ✅ Experience with DevOps tools such as Jenkins, Docker, Kubernetes, Terraform, etc 2 stage interview process: 1st stage technical pairing (1hr) Final stage competency based (2hr more »
able to interview right away as the client would like this process wrapped up by early June Requirements: PowerShell or Bean Shell. TestDrivenDevelopment decoupled from external systems. REST Asynchronous messaging, and database integration. As per the above, this role will be up to 1 day more »
with these in a commercial environment. You should also be familiar with automating CI/CD practices using Fastlane as well as practices like TDD and Pair Porgramming. There is likely to be a mentoring element to this role where you will pair programme with other more junior developers in more »
based in London, however also managing two 3rd party offshore teams. (Total management of 3 teams, circa 20 staff) Experience in test-drivendevelopment (TDD) with a strong understanding of SOLID principles and clean coding, agile methodology, best practices A background in development, preferably C#/ more »
in overseeing and nurturing junior talent. Proficiency in Java or Kotlin, with a focus on constructing contemporary microservices. A robust grasp of Test-DrivenDevelopment (TDD) methodologies. Prior hands-on experience with Kafka and streaming technologies. In addition to the above, you'll enjoy a generous training more »
Senior Java Developer - Java, Scala, Fixed Income, Low Latency, HTML, React, BDD, TDD I am currently seeking an experienced Java developer to join my client who is a leading investment bank based in Canary Wharf, London. You will be joining a high-performing team to help deliver a new pricing … good fit for the role please get in contact - adam.wirth@nicollcurtin.com Senior Algo Java Developer - Java, Scala, Fixed Income, Low Latency, HTML, React, BDD, TDDmore »
Senior Full Stack Developer - Up to £95k - Hybrid Tech Stack: Ruby on Rails, JavaScript, React, TDD Salary: Up to 95k Location: Central London Office Industry: Software Development House Smooth Interview Process !! The Company 🚀 An exciting software development house based in the heart of London are looking for a … will be expected to be client facing right from the offset, which further enhances the individuals development. Desired Skills ⚙️ Ruby on Rails JavaScript React TDD If this Senior Ruby Developer role sounds of interest, please get in touch, actively interviewing!! Senior Full Stack Developer - Up to £95k - Hybrid more »
Hounslow, London, United Kingdom Hybrid / WFH Options
Understanding Recruitment
years of experience in Software Engineering. Proficiency in Java or Kotlin, with a focus on building modern microservices. A strong understanding of Test-DrivenDevelopment (TDD) methodologies. Hands-on experience with Kafka and streaming technologies. In addition, you will enjoy: A generous training allocation. Frequent company gatherings. more »
with cloud services and infrastructure (AWS, Azure). ** Knowledge of RESTful and SOAP APIs, and microservices architecture. ** Agile methodology experience, particularly Scrum ** Test-drivendevelopment (TDD) and continuous integration/continuous deployment (CI/CD) pipelines ** Strong understanding of version control systems (e.g., Git) ** Ability to write more »
City of London, London, United Kingdom Hybrid / WFH Options
Client Server
experience of working with microservices and AWS cloud based services You have full software development lifecycle experience, including testing your own code e.g. TDD, Unit testing You're collaborative, enjoy problem solving and working with others to overcome technical challenges What's in it for you: As a Software more »
to extend and modernise our existing systems. Entity Framework, React, RESTful, Razor Pages, Javascript, React, Angular, JQuery, Bootstrap, SQL Server, Version control (Git & DevOps), TDD, Jira, Azure DevOps development. Partly Remote - 3 days a week in the office + good benefits. Adlam Consulting operates as an Employment Agency & an Employment more »
Alexander Mann Solutions - Public Sector Resourcing
experience with Terraform or similar IaC Good understanding of Geospatial technologies especially QGIS and ArcGIS Experience of testing concepts from unit testing through to TDD, BDD and writing manual and automated tests Git as version control Active SC Clearance more »
languages: Python, Maven. Cloud services: AWS, Google Cloud Platform or Azure Software design patterns and best practice. Docker container technology APIs, caching and messaging. TDD/BDD and best practise with CI/CD pipelines. Developing highly performant quality applications on cloud. Strong communication skills with a customer centric focus. more »
/or htmx) Experience of any Python frameworks – Flask, FastAPI or similar Good understanding of agile software engineering practices, methods and tools (BDD/TDD etc) Appetite for continual experimentation & learning Any Cloud experience (AWS or Azure or GCP) Nice to have (not mandatory): Database experience – SQL or NoSQL Knowledge more »
Experience is a plus but not essential Fullstack exposure with either Golang, Node, C#, Java, Python etc Cloud experience - AWS/GCP/Azure TDD, BDD, Clean architecture Salary/Package on offer: Salary: Up to £95,000 + Bonus Remote (UK Based) with in frequent onsite visits in Central more »
following technologies: Essential Requirements: 5+ years Java experience 2+ practical experience in Spring Boot Microservices Architecture Experience in 3 or more of the following: TDD Automated acceptance testing/BDD/Cucumber Performance and scalability testing, e.g. JMeter Penetration testing knowledge/OWASP Kubernetes/Container orchestration platform experience Designing more »
architecture, message queuing, and cloud technologies. Documenting with tools such as Postman, Swagger, and Lucidchart. Exposure to DevOps. Familiarity with Entity Framework. Knowledge of TDD, Agile and Scrum methodologies Responsibilities Collaborate with the Tech Lead, Business Analysts, and Product Managers to accurately interpret technical specifications, explore solutions, provide developmentmore »
e.g., CSV, JSON and XML Building reliable Data Pipelines Broader knowledge of IT — e.g., Security and Networking Working in an Agile Environment Test-DrivenDevelopment and/or Behaviour DrivenDevelopment Continuous Integration and Continuous Deployment (CI/CD) Experience of operating as a technical more »
technologies and you’ll need to be familiar with the principles of a modern standards approach, such as continuous integration and delivery, test-drivendevelopment, and cloud services. You’ll have an awareness of design patterns and how to implement them appropriately with security in mind and more »
e.g., CSV, JSON and XML Building reliable Data Pipelines Broader knowledge of IT — e.g., Security and Networking Working in an Agile Environment Test-DrivenDevelopment and/or Behaviour DrivenDevelopment Continuous Integration and Continuous Deployment (CI/CD) Experience of operating as a technical more »
totally up to you! Essential Skills: Java (ideally 8 or 11) Experience within Finance Blockchain Kafka Kubernetes CI/CD and relevant tooling (Jenkins) TDD Docker Desirable: Kotlin Blockchain technologies Benefits: Salary up to £130 000 pa Private medical Discretionary Bonus (previously 20-30%) Discretionary annual salary review 26 days more »
Greater London, England, United Kingdom Hybrid / WFH Options
Understanding Recruitment
million in staffing costs. As a Staff Software Engineer, you will: Have experience with JVM e.g. Java/Kotlin , Microservices , AWS , CI/CD , TDD , Agile Be open to (or already have experience) working with Kotlin Have front end experience or be happy to work with React Have previously led more »